Celebrating Parker’s Corner: Honouring A Legacy Of Love and Inclusion in Saint John

By Giv'er Saint John / August 13, 2025

The City of Saint John is proud to formally recognize the corner of Carmarthen and Mecklenburg streets as Parker’s Corner, a tribute to the late Parker Grant Cogswell, an inspiring advocate for LGBTQ+ rights, inclusion, and community spirit.
